The 1977 Houston Astros season was a season in American baseball. The team finished third in the National League West with a record of 81-81, 17 games behind the Los Angeles Dodgers.

Season standings [edit]

NL West W L GB Pct.
Los Angeles Dodgers 98 64 -- .605
Cincinnati Reds 88 74 10 .543
Houston Astros 81 81 17 .500
San Francisco Giants 75 87 23 .463
San Diego Padres 69 93 29 .426
Atlanta Braves 61 101 37 .377
